    Quote Originally Posted by Intersocial View Post
    Yo @Empired; or @Shar; you might know.

    What's the average amount of time it takes to actually give blood (from when it comes out your arm > pint full). I'm sure I found it online ages ago but googling didn't help me.

    I only ask cause today it took me 4 minutes which I thought was quite quick, especially considering it took me 9 minutes last time
    The actual blood donation typically takes less than 10-12 minutes. The entire process, from the time you arrive to the time you leave, takes about an hour and 15 min.
